DC-MLL mailing received today annoucing the following change to the member agreement effective Feb 1/02:

<font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if" size="2">Charges made in a foreign currency: If you incur a Charge in a foreign currency, we will convert the Charge into Canadian dollars at the conversion rate in effect on the day we process the Charge, plus 2% of the converted amount. Amounts converted by common carriers, such as airlines, will be billed at the rates the carriers use for conversion, plus 2% of the converted amount </font>
This increase from 1% effectively negates the mileage accumulation benefit, as stated above by MoreMiles (for CIBC Aerogold).
